Lair is a small place in Harrison County, Kentucky, in the United States. It's called an unincorporated community, which means it doesn't have its own local government like a city or town. Lair is located about 3.4 miles (5.5 km) south of a bigger town called Cynthiana, right along U.S. Route 27.

History of Lair: How the Community Began

The community of Lair was named after an early settler in the area, a man named Isaac Newton Lair. He was one of the first people to live there and helped the community grow.

The Story of Lair's Post Office

A post office was first opened in Lair in 1860. Back then, it was known as Lair's Station. This was an important place for people to send and receive letters and packages. In 1882, the name was shortened to just Lair. The post office served the community for many years until it closed down in 1920.

Businesses in Early Lair

In the 1870s, Lair was a busy little community. It had a general store where people could buy everyday items. There were also two gristmills, which were places where grain was ground into flour. This was very important for farmers. The community also had two distilleries, which made alcoholic drinks. These businesses helped the community thrive in its early days.
